Return of the Connolly Column

FIBI would like to thank everyone who contributed to such a fitting tribute to the members of the International Brigades at the Workmans Club in Dublin on Friday November 23, 2018. The musicians gave so much of themselves and their talent to make this 80th commemoration of the return of the Connolly Column such a special occasion – from the very first moment everyone lucky enough to be there realised this would be a night to remember. So, a huge thank you to Colm Morgan, Mick Hanley, Donal Lunny, Tony Sweeney, Muireann Nic Amhlaoibh, John Faulkner, Andy Irvine and Gallo Rojo. Also to Justin McCarthy for his poignant narration of Charlie Donnelly's The Tolerance of Crows. A huge thank you also to everyone who bought tickets, to those who bought merchandise too and to those who could not be present but still sent donations. People travelled from all over Ireland and beyond to be there. The proceeds from the night, which was completely sold out, will ensure our work will continue to prosper and remain relevant. There is so much work to be done but we will never have more inspiring people than those who defended the Spanish Republic. Perhaps the only sombre note in what was a celebration of anti-fascist resistance was the recognition that many of those who gave everything in Spain would perhaps never realise their legacy would be so cherished, their names forever remembered. But we do remember them now more than ever they have become an inspiration for this and future generations of people who recognise the dangers around us and the complacency that allows fascism to become somehow acceptable. In the immortal words of La Pasionara’s farewell address to the brigaders read out at the concert: "Today many are departing. Thousands remain, shrouded in Spanish earth, profoundly remembered by all Spaniards. Comrades of the International Brigades: Political reasons, reasons of state, the welfare of that very cause for which you offered your blood with boundless generosity, are sending you back, some to your own countries and others to forced exile. You can go proudly. "You are history. You are legend. You are the heroic example of democracy's solidarity and universality in the face of the vile and accommodating spirit of those who interpret democratic principles with their eyes on hoards of wealth or corporate shares which they want to safeguard from all risk.
